SPEAR3 Top-Off Injection

SSRL will employ a frequent fill schedule with 10 minutes between SPEAR3 injections starting on June 7, 2010. In order to provide users with a predictable fill schedule in case of injector problems, we have provided the following guidelines for the SPEAR3 operators:

Frequent Fill Schedule:

  1. Automatic injections will be conducted every 10 minutes to maintain SPEAR3 current stability to better than 1%.


  2. Automatic injections will only occur at the designated 10 minute intervals (i.e., on the hour and every ten minutes thereafter). If the injector is not functional at the designated fill time, then the fill will be skipped.


  3. If injection problems result in stored current decay below 180 mA, then once the injector is functional a 30 minute warning will be provided prior to injection. The 10 minute injection pattern will restart at the next designated fill time after the 30 minute warning.


  4. If automatic injection cannot resume, then manual fills will be conducted at 0600, 1400, and 2200.


  5. If step losses result in less than 180 mA stored current, then SPEAR3 will be re-injected immediately.
